InfoHENDERSON, James Henry Dickey, a Representative from Oregon; born near Salem, Ky., July 23, 1810; moved to Missouri Territory in 1817; attended the public schools; learned the art of printing; entered the ministry and was pastor of a church in Washington County, Pa., 1843-1851; returned to Missouri and published a literary magazine; moved to Oregon in 1852 and settled in Yamhill County; moved to Eugene, Lane County, and engaged in agricultural pursuits, specializing in the raising of fruits; superintendent of the public schools of Lane County in 1859; elected as a Republican to the Thirty-ninth Congress (March 4, 1865-March 3, 1867); unsuccessful candidate for renomination in 1866; returned to Eugene, Oreg., and engaged in agricultural pursuits; also preached, lectured, and wrote for periodicals; died in Eugene, Oreg., December 13, 1885; interment in Odd Fellows Cemetery.
